From 40f0c0e99c9e8782ecb1e7c1db2dce31bc41d28e Mon Sep 17 00:00:00 2001 From: George Warner Date: Mon, 20 May 2019 18:01:14 -0700 Subject: [PATCH] Layout Editor Turnout Color Change Don't base Layout turnout colors on continuing sense state. --- java/src/jmri/jmrit/display/layoutEditor/LayoutTurnout.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/java/src/jmri/jmrit/display/layoutEditor/LayoutTurnout.java b/java/src/jmri/jmrit/display/layoutEditor/LayoutTurnout.java index 5542d804db9..cf5b1f3285f 100644 --- a/java/src/jmri/jmrit/display/layoutEditor/LayoutTurnout.java +++ b/java/src/jmri/jmrit/display/layoutEditor/LayoutTurnout.java @@ -4224,7 +4224,7 @@ protected void highlightUnconnected(Graphics2D g2, int specificType) { protected void drawTurnoutControls(Graphics2D g2) { if (!disabled && !(disableWhenOccupied && isOccupied())) { Color foregroundColor = g2.getColor(); - if (!isInContinuingSenseState()) { + if (getState() == Turnout.CLOSED) { Color backgroundColor = g2.getBackground(); g2.setColor(backgroundColor); } @@ -4233,7 +4233,7 @@ protected void drawTurnoutControls(Graphics2D g2) { } else { g2.draw(layoutEditor.trackControlCircleAt(center)); } - if (!isInContinuingSenseState()) { + if (getState() == Turnout.CLOSED) { g2.setColor(foregroundColor); } }